The Benefits of One-To-One Driving Instruction
One-to-one driving instruction customizes the discovering experience particularly to the requirements of specific students. Below are a number of advantages of this method:
BenefitsDescriptionPersonalized Learning ExperienceEvery student has unique strengths and weak points. One-to-one instruction provides personalized attention, assisting students get rid of particular challenges.Comfy Learning EnvironmentMany students feel more at ease when they receive instruction in an individually setting. This comfort can reduce stress and anxiety and boost focus.Versatile SchedulingLearners can often select their own schedule, making it simpler to fit lessons around other dedications.Immediate FeedbackInstructors can supply real-time feedback, allowing students to correct mistakes instantaneously and solidifying these lessons for future drives.Focused Skill DevelopmentIndividually instruction enables the instructor to concentrate on the specific skills that the student requires to develop, whether it’s parking, combining, or browsing intricate road systems.Real-Life Applications

While each driving school might vary in its curriculum, a lot of one-to-one driving instruction follows a structured format developed to guide students through multiple phases:
Lesson NumberFocusObjectives1Basics of Vehicle OperationComprehending cars and truck controls, changing mirrors, and safety checks.2Beginning and StoppingTechniques for smooth velocity and braking, consisting of emergency stops.3Turning and ManeuveringPracticing turns, lane modifications, and driving in different environments.4Parking and ReversingProficiency of parking techniques, parallel parking, and reversing securely.5Road Signs and RulesFamiliarity with traffic signs, signals, and right of way guidelines.6Driving in Various ConditionsTechniques for rain, fog, and night driving.7Mock Driving TestSimulated driving test to assess readiness for licensing.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. 2. What should I try to find in a trainer?
When selecting a driving instructor, consider their credentials, experience, teaching design, and connection. It is important to select someone who makes you feel comfy yet challenged.
3. Is one-to-one instruction more expensive than group lessons?
One-to-one instruction can be more expensive upfront due to the personalized attention. However, many learners find that this investment saves them time and ultimately leads to a higher pass rate for driving tests.
4. Can I arrange lessons around my existing commitments?
A lot of driving schools use flexible scheduling to accommodate the learner’s accessibility, consisting of nights and weekends.
